Output 3dedf415fa1dea10380298035545c07684b3a78302da201f934b768f2fb9e66b:1

value
17460000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55fc7b7253d5c7cb0dcfca69bf8e9b8b67135c62 OP_EQUAL
address
39XfpcyWCdA35CVbwTxChd2o8CaLfj7o2a
transaction
3dedf415fa1dea10380298035545c07684b3a78302da201f934b768f2fb9e66b
spent
true